Avatar universal
I have had this a few times. The trick is knowing when to see a Dr. If it bleeds like a period go. If it doesn't heal in a week, go see a Dr. If there is a flap from the tear go Dr. If it starts to ooze anything that isn't blood, go Dr. If it is in the actual vaginal passage not just labia go Dr.  If you are really worried always better to be safe than sorry. It will be sore and uncomfortable for first few days. Best to keep checking in a mirror for progress.

Lubricate!!! There are several ways to get wet & prevent vaginal tears.
1) Have long, slow, sexy foreplay that gets you very hot & wet.
2) Have him make you climax first with mouth or hand. Believe me - most of us girls get very wet on the way to an orgasm!
3) Use a good lubricant. Pjur is pricey but never gets sticky & can be used on the inside or outside of the body. Use it on yourself all around your opening and inside. Slather his penis with it. Smooth sliding prevents tears & pain.
4) Have him enter you an inch at a time at first. Start with slow, shallow strokes then deeper over time. He should NEVER ram into you right away. If he insists he is selfish & should be fired as a lover.

It sounds like like lack of lubrication is a problem for many of you but here is another idea to consider...

Channel 4, UK have just broadcast a program featuring a girl with similar symptoms to some of you (broadcast channel 4 Weds 29th July 09, 8pm "Embarrassing Teanage Bodies".

She was having pain after sex, inflamed vulva and lots of little cuts. She'd been to 3 doctors and none of them helped her. In the program she showed her problem to a doctor who referred her to a sexual health professional. After ruling out sexually transmitted infections by doing a full sexual health check the specialist then referred the girl onto a dermatologist (skin specialist). He diagnosed Vulvodynia (pain and inflamation of the vulval area with unknown cause). This can also be known as Vulvar Vestibulitis when it is in a more localised area around the vestibule or Vestibular Adenitis. He prescribed her a special soap and cream to use every morning (unfortunately it didn't say what the cream was). Anyway, they followed up with her later in the program and she said her condition had massively improved and she was now experiencing virtually no pain at all!

I think the moral of the story here girls is to persevere! Do not take "no" for an answer and do not let doctors tell you to ignore it. It is not normal to experience pain like that and you shouldn't have to put up with it. If they try and turn you away demand to be referred to a sexual health specialist or dermatologist. Or seek another opinion from another doctor if they will not give you the referral you need.

I have had this problem for a while. It seems that I must lubricate before intercourse or had a decent amount of foreplay. However this tear stings when my husband ejaculates.

Recently I have been using an ointment on the tear called Calendula a natural product. It has helped. Also lean forward when I urinate so that urine does not enter my vagina.

I have been told that warm baths are good for healing tears. My gynecologist prescribe estodiol cream which has helped too. However it's an ongoing issue.
